MEGA SCANDAL.  When Airtel Uganda unveiled its new Managing Director, Soumendra Sahu aka Soum in 2024, replacing the then outgoing boss Manoj Murali, staff across the company were filled with optimism. His inaugural address, centred on digital transformation, connectivity and innovation, left employees convinced that a new and promising chapter had been opened. But one year down the road, that optimism has curdled into frustration and fear.









Today, the telecom veteran, once embraced as a visionary leader, Soum finds himself at the centre of a storm, facing fierce criticism from nearly every corner of the Airtel Towers, headquartered along Clement Hill Road, in the Capital, Kampala.

This story is based on a 2454-word missive, supposedly written by the bigger family of Airtel Staff, and directed to the Group CEO, Sunil Taldar. The dossier in our possession, and the same our prominent sources at Airtel have, on condition of anonymity, confirmed its authenticity to us, unveils the supposed rot inside the walls of the telecom giant.




The tough-written dossier, whose authors remain unnamed in these pages for their own protection, warns the Group CEO of the looming crisis; “As it seems now, you may have your worst performances in many of the departments by Q4 if we continue this way and [we] will try to share what we know for all departments and the reasons why,” reads the dossier in its intro section.




Sunil`s Deaf Ears. However, the staff plight seems to have fallen on deaf ears of the Group CEO, Sunil Taldar. This stance, because we have landed on another email, accusing him of the same. “Dear Sunil, we are following up to understand the progress made on the issues outlined in the attached document. The team’s concerns regarding Soum remain unchanged, and there is a growing perception that this behavior is being tolerated,” reads an authoritative message.

The authors proceed to encourage their colleagues to speak up and suppress the `oppressor` against them. “Additionally, other colleagues on the Ugandan team should be encouraged to speak up and express themselves freely, as many have felt silenced and fearful for a long time.” When contacted, the Airtel PRO David Birungi said he wasn’t aware of the dossier but promised to drop in his comment upon getting a copy, possibly at our end. Finance department – “Manipulated Figures and Pressure”. If there was ever a department that we thought was happy, it was finance, because they would be happy with many cost cutting initiatives but this is NOT the case and we will give examples. Many of the senior managers in this department are unhappy, even with their own Finance Director (FD). He often speaks to them rudely and pressures them to manipulate financial figures.




We urge you to pay close attention to the decrement figures being reported under Gross Ads, as they are concerning. Currently, we record over 1 million gross ads from the same customers, many of whom hold more than 10 SIM cards under a single national ID. This practice significantly distorts the net ads figures, and no amount of marketing or campaign effort can change that reality.




Furthermore, the team is being compelled to produce reports that disregard IFRS standards, simply to please Soum and present an overly positive picture to you. While the truth will eventually come to light, we felt it was important to bring this to your attention now.
